Snacks
Beginning with the September school year, a reminder
that the school will no longer be providing snacks for the
children. This was done to ensure that children have
snacks that they enjoy (it is very difficult to find items that
all children in the class enjoy and will eat!). Parents should
pack 2 healthy snacks along with the child’s lunch (1
snack for half day programs). We recommend fruit and
vegetable options and/or healthy crackers as best
options. In order to ensure the health and safety of all
students, we ask that all snacks and meals be free of nuts.
We are currently investigating the feasibility of adding a
hot lunch program in the future which would provide
snacks as well as lunch. We will keep you posted and likely
ask for your opinion via survey in the coming months.

First Day Checklist
As September quickly approaches, a reminder checklist for the first day of school:
• Lunch and snacks (labelled with your child’s name)
• One box of tissues
• Bedding for nap time (pillow, blanket, bed sheet)
• Placemat for lunch time (can be rolled and is washable)
• One pair of indoor shoes
• At least one extra set of clothes (complete outfit)
• Emergency bag that includes a bottle of water, energy bar/cookie, family photo with
family information on reverse, full change of clothes (complete outfit including shoes;
this is in addition to the extra set of clothes noted above), emergency blanket,
flashlight, whistle and a small stuffed toy.
